Cochran Associates is a full-service architecture and design firm located in Lawrenceville, one of Pittsburgh's most historic and interesting neighborhoods. It was opened by Keith Cochran in 1994 with the intent of providing quality design services for projects of all types, including Custom Residential Design, Historic Preservation and Adaptive Reuse, Commercial Interiors, High-tech Building Design, Museum Design, and Library Design. We also have made a commitment to sustainable design practices, and have incorporated them into most of our projects. Over the years, we have been very fortunate to work on a very diversified array of such projects, and have received numerous awards for historic preservation, and sustainable design. We are very proud of the Pittsburgh Project Guest House, which received the LEED gold rating given by the United States Green Building Council.


Cochran Associates uses ArchiCAD for all of it's projects. ArchiCAD is a state of the art CAD system which enables clients to view their projects in three dimensional drawings from the initial stages of design through the completion of the project. We can also create solar studies to view the effect of the sun on a building facade at a specific time on a specific selected day of the year.  Using fly-throughs of a project, clients may walk through the virtual environment in a "to-scale", animated  presentation. Our clients have told us that these three dimensional studies are instrumental in their understanding of the design.
